Racist assholes act accordingly in Houston (my headline)

Supporters of Trayvon Martin and George Zimmerman came face-to-face Sunday during a march through a wealthy neighborhood in Houston.

Some 80 pro-Zimmerman supporters waved signs and shouted slogans at Martin supporters as they passed through the neighborhood of River Oaks, an upscale enclave deemed "Houston's Sanford, Florida" by the organizer of the Trayvon rally, the Houston Chronicle reported.


Separated by cops on horseback and specialized crowd control units, the two sides traded insults and shouted slogans at each another but never clashed physically.
